313 The First Kansas Infantry, out of seven hundred and eighty-five men, lost two hundred and ninety-six.

The loss in other regiments was quite severe, though not proportionately as heavy as the above.

These two regiments did not break during the battle, and when they left the ground they marched off as coolly as from a parade.
At the time our retreat was ordered our ammunition was nearly exhausted and the ranks fearfully thinned.
